Will Air Bags Improve Ride Quality and Sag for 2012 Volkswagen Jetta SportWagen Towing a Trailer
Updated 06/10/2014 | Published 06/09/2014 >
Products Featured in This Question
Question:
Hi I pull a small Coleman Pop-Up trailer with my 2012 Jetta Sportwagon TDI. It does a fine job, but the back is lowered by the tongue weight. Would the Firestone Air Bags provide me with a level car and better suspension? Thanks
asked by: Carl H
Expert Reply:
The best solution for sag and poor ride quality caused by towing a trailer is weight distribution and not suspension enhancement. But the hitches for your 2012 Volkswagen Jetta Sportwagen are not rated for weight distribution. The next best ting would be suspension enhancement.
Firestone kit # F2158 can be used with Coil-Rite system # F4176 which fits your Jetta SportWagen. They will provide a better ride and decrease sag caused by carrying a heavy load. I have linked the installation instructions for you to view.
